Q: Is 9,202,155 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,202,155 is a composite number.

Why is 9,202,155 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,202,155 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 61 89 113 183 267 305 339 445 565 915 1,335 1,695 5,429 6,893 10,057 16,287 20,679 27,145 30,171 34,465 50,285 81,435 103,395 150,855 613,477 1,840,431 3,067,385 and 9,202,155, with no remainder.

Since 9,202,155 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,202,155, it is a composite number.
